The universal law of gravitation was propounded by?
1. Newton
2. Galileo
3. Kepler
4. Copernicus

Correct Answer - Option 1 : Newton

The correct answer is Newton.

 

  • Universal Law of gravitation was formulated by Sir Issac Newton. 

  •  It states that Every body in universe attracts every other body with a force which is directly proportional to the product of their masses and inversely proportional to the square of distance between them.
    • The force acts along the line joining the two bodies.
    • The gravitational force is a central force that is It acts along the line joining the centers of two bodies.
    • It is a conservative force. This means that the work done by the gravitational force in displacing a body from one point to another is only dependent on the initial and final positions of the body and is independent of the path followed.
